Case study

Trading station

Automatic financial analysis and stock market trading via the Interactive Brokers API.

Trading station

About the client

Trading Station is a product created for Minerva Digital Intelligence Srl. It is a company from northern Italy that deals with data analysis and software development.

Company
Minerva Digital Intelligence Srl
Country
Italy
Work Done
  • Design
  • Development
  • Monitoring
Website
minervadigitalintelligence.com

Description

Trading Station is a desktop application created to communicate with the Interactive Brokers API to read stock market data and perform automatic trades.

The application can be configured by the user via a user interface and has historical data saved on a local database.

Development Process

Step 1

Design

We reviewed the goals and determined what features to implement and how

Step 2

Development

I developed the application providing constant feedback to meet the customer's needs.

Step 3

Monitoring

We monitor the application, how users use it and what features we should add or improve.

Tech stack used for this project

Programming Languages:

C# C# SQL SQL

Frameworks, Libraries and More:

.NET .NET Windows Forms Windows Forms EF Core EF Core SQLite SQLite

Software architecture

The application uses Windows Forms as the graphical framework

It connects to the Interactive Brokers API via the C# library they provide, from which it listens for changes in the market.

The application connects to a local Sqlite database.

Free Consultation

Discover how to improve your business with generative AI and/or custom software.

Includes:
  • Business needs analysis
  • Software design
  • ROI calculation
  • Quote with price and timing
Free Consultation
Quote